** The general auto repair market serving Frederick, Illinois, is characteristic of a rural, small-town environment. The competition is not dense within the village itself, but robust within a 10-15 mile radius in neighboring communities like Ipava and Table Grove. The quality of service is generally high, with shops building their reputation on trust, longevity, and deep community ties. These businesses typically employ seasoned technicians who are versatile and capable of working on a wide range of vehicle makes and models, from daily commuters to farm equipment. Pricing is typically competitive and often more affordable than in larger urban centers, reflecting the local cost of living. However, the market is not saturated with budget chains, so the focus is on value and reliability rather than deep discounting. Customers in this area prioritize trustworthy diagnostics and durable repairs over speed or the lowest possible price. For highly specialized work (e.g., complex European imports), residents may need to travel to larger hubs like Macomb or Peoria.
